Searches leading to this page

Electronics in Sagolband, Imphal Electronics in Imphal in Sagolband, Imphal in Sagolband, Imphal Rd Computer Solution, Sagolband Rd Computer Solution, Sagolband Deals Rd Computer Solution, Sagolband, Imphal
"nx_t": "Dec. 6, 2025, 4:16 p.m.","as_t": ""